Meaning of Dafeenah
Dafeenah originates from the classical Arabic verb ‘دفن’ (dafana), which means ‘to bury’ or ‘to conceal.’ The feminine form ‘Dafeenah’ specifically translates to ‘hidden treasure’ or ‘buried wealth,’ carrying connotations of something precious that is not immediately visible. This name reflects Arabic linguistic traditions where names often describe desirable qualities or metaphorical concepts. The root word appears in various Arabic contexts, including literature and historical texts, where ‘dafeen’ refers to treasures buried for safekeeping. The name’s meaning emphasizes value, protection, and the idea that true worth often lies beneath the surface.

Origin & Cultural Significance
Dafeenah has its roots in Arabic language and culture, particularly among Arab and Muslim communities across the Middle East, North Africa, and South Asia. The name reflects traditional naming practices where meaningful adjectives and nouns are transformed into personal names. While not among the most common Arabic names, Dafeenah appears in historical records and continues to be used in modern times, especially in regions with strong Arabic linguistic influence. The concept of hidden treasure has cultural significance in Arab heritage, often appearing in folklore and poetry as metaphors for wisdom, love, or spiritual wealth.
